Boston Symphony Orchestra Boston Symphony Hall Tickets & Info
Experience an unforgettable evening with the Boston Symphony Orchestra at Symphony Hall on November 28, 2025. Renowned for their exceptional artistry and innovative approach, the BSO consistently receives critical acclaim for their musical excellence and engaging performances. This concert features the passionate cellist Pablo Ferrández performing Dvořák’s soulful Cello Concerto, alongside the orchestra's stirring interpretation of Dvořák’s Symphony No. 8, a piece celebrated for its vibrant melodies and Czech national spirit. Boston Symphony Orchestra Concerts Boston Symphony Hall
Boston Symphony Hall stands as a historic and iconic venue in Boston, renowned for its exceptional acoustics and rich musical heritage. As the home of the Boston Symphony Orchestra, it hosts a diverse array of performances, including their acclaimed summer concerts in public parks, which bring symphonic music to a broader audience. Parking & Directions for Boston Symphony Orchestra Boston Symphony Hall
301 Massachusetts Avenue, Boston, MA
02115, US
1. Boston Common Garage - 0.5 miles, approx. $30
2. Prudential Center Garage - 0.5 miles, approx. $25
3. Copley Place Garage - 0.6 miles, approx. $28
4. 100 Clarendon Street Garage - 0.3 miles, approx. $32
5. Hynes Convention Center Garage - 0.5 miles, approx. $20
